I thank God for His grace towards me. I got admitted to the university in 2002 for my first degree. It was going to be a whole new experience to me as I was schooling outside the state where I was born and had been all my life. I had a plan all mapped out.
I had heard a lot about university life and I was going to make sure I lived it to the full. No where in that plan was God.
My first few months at the university worked out as planned. I made some friends and we were "rocking" the campus.
We used to hang out every night and life seemed on the fab lane. Then on the 5th of July 2003, my life changed. I had seen posters around campus about a program (Freshers' Classique) being organised by Believers' LoveWorld campus fellowship in my school, University of Benin. Well, it never got my attention.
The program was scheduled to commence at 5pm at the school auditorium. Around this time, I was to hook up with some of my gang members down-town, as was our usual practice. I tried to get a bus which would take me to the school gate but I couldn't get any. My best bet was to take a short route, through the school's auditorium and get to the gate.
I decided to take it and lo, while I passed the auditorium, I heard people shouting in joy.
Now, I had been on campus for a few months and I knew that the only time people shouted like that that was when an artiste was performing at an event (musical events). I hurriedly ran to the auditorium to find out who it was. When I got in, I saw a man in suit, and to my amazement, he wasn't singing or cracking jokes.
He was preaching! I wondered to my self, why the excitement? Before now, church was that boring place you go to where guilt takes a better part of you. But here I was, and as he spoke about Jesus Christ, people screamed in joy, some with tears in their eyes. I took a seat and listened to this artiste, as he kept on preaching about the love of Christ.
Tears welled up in my eyes and immediately the call for salvation was made, I ran to the altar and received Christ into my life.
That same day, I got filled with the Holy Spirit and spoke in other tongues. My life had been changed. I kept attending meetings and kept growing in the word. The zeal for God's house consumed me.
I didn't even know when I broke off from my crew. I just kept burning for God. God had redesigned my plan.
I spent six fulfilled years at the university.
I won souls, got many filled with the Holy Ghost, ministered to the sick and kept waxing stronger in the word. Today, I see my seed and I'm grateful to God for using me to reach out to them.
